资源预览内容
第1页 / 共15页
第2页 / 共15页
第3页 / 共15页
第4页 / 共15页
第5页 / 共15页
第6页 / 共15页
第7页 / 共15页
第8页 / 共15页
第9页 / 共15页
第10页 / 共15页
亲,该文档总共15页,到这儿已超出免费预览范围,如果喜欢就下载吧!
资源描述
面向复杂产品的离散装配过程控制与管理系统针对复杂产品的装配数据管理分散,生产现场的装配数据可视化和实时化程度不高的问题,引入工作流管理技术,构建了一个面向复杂产品的计算机辅助装配过程控制与管理系统,建立了该系统的体系结构、功能结构和运行流程。研究了基于装配BOM的静态装配数据管理、基于流程的动态装配数据管理、装配工艺报表格式化输出和装配现场实时可视化监控等关键技术。该系统以装配工艺流程为核心,有效地实现了流程化的装配工艺设计、装配车间的计划调度和实时监控、装配数据的实时采集与统计分析,为离散型装配企业提供了一个统一的精细化装配管理解决方案0 引言 复杂产品是指客户需求复杂、产品组成复杂、产品技术复杂、制造过程复杂、项目管理复杂的一类产品,如航天器、飞机、复杂机电产品、武器系统等。复杂产品装配是典型的离散型装配,具有研制周期长、零部件组成数量庞大、涉及的专业领域广、以手工装配作业为主、单件小批量生产等特点。装配是复杂产品生产的最后环节,也是最为重要的环节之一,实现复杂产品的装配过程科学管理与监控,可显著提高其产品的生产效率和装配质量。 近年来,国内外相关研究机构从装配数据管理、装配工艺设计和装配车间看板技术等方面开展了相关研究,但是从学术界的理论研究和工程应用角度来看,仍然有如下问题值得关注: 1)装配执行现场的装配过程和装配数据集成管理问题。在装配数据管理方面,目前国内研究主要聚焦于产品静态装配数据的组织结构以及BOM视图之间的映射和转换方面,缺乏对产品装配过程中的装配数据动态演变过程模型的研究,装配数据管理和过程管理相脱节。 2)生产现场的装配工艺信息可视化展示和工艺执行过程中的实时监控问题。在车间现场的装配工艺展示形式上,目前国内工程中常采用卡片式的装配工艺卡片(例如天河CAPP的工艺卡片)来指导现场装配,这种集成卡片式的装配工艺规程主要依靠自然语言进行工艺内容的描述,辅之以一定数量的二维装配示意图,这种方式导致了对装配工艺的描述不形象、不直观、不规范,造成了装配工人不易快速准确地理解装配工艺,严重影响产品的装配质量和效率。在装配车间的工艺执行管理方面(即装配车间的生产调度方面),现有MES系统基本上专门针对装配车间的解决方案,普遍缺乏准确、及时、完整的数据采集与信息反馈机制,在底层数据的实时采集、多源信息融合、复杂信息处理及快速决策等方面较为薄弱,导致生产现场的数据(包括工艺数据、管理数据、齐套数据等)比较分散,可视化和实时化程度不高的现状,管理人员和操作者很难实时、快速查看到自己所需的数据和内容。 针对目前国内外的大多数研究成果还不能满足复杂产品装配现场数据管理集成化、过程监控实时可视化和精细化要求的现状。笔者结合航天复杂产品的工程实践,提出了一种基于流程的产品装配过程控制与管理技术,同时设计并开发了面向生产现场的复杂产品计算机辅助装配过程控制与管理系统VPPC(Visual Production Process Control &Management),为装配现场的实时监控和数据集成管理提供了一条新的途径。1 系统的总体结构 基于工作流的计算机辅助装配过程控制与管理系统的工作流程如图1所示,该方法主要包括装配工艺设计层、车间作业计划制定层、车间作业计划执行层三部分。1.1 装配工艺设计层 装配工艺设计层主要包括工艺准备计划调度、装配BOM构建、基于流程的装配工艺设计三部分,其中基于流程的装配工艺设计是核心。 1)工艺准备计划调度:工艺师在装配工艺设计之前,首先应接收工艺准备计划指令,并排定所有装配工艺文件的完成时间和完成人。 2)装配BOM构建:工艺师在接收到装配工艺准备指令后,在产品设计BOM的基础上,建立统一的产品装配BOM,并确保相应产品节点下所有信息的完整,为后续的装配工艺设计奠定数据基础。 3)基于流程的装配工艺设计:工艺师按照时间节点完成装配工艺文件的编制,并提交审签。 图1 基于工作流的计算机辅助装配过程控制与管理系统的工作流程示意图 复杂产品的装配工艺由一个串(并)联混而成的装配工序链组成。复杂产品装配作业前,通常要绘制产品的装配工艺流程图,并按工艺流程图组织装配工作。结合复杂产品装配工艺设计与装配作业的特点,提出了一种基于流程的装配工艺设计方法,该方法由装配工艺流程图生成、装配节点的信息加载和装配工艺报表输出三部分组成。 装配工艺流程图生成,是指针对每一个具体型号的产品,创建一个与该产品相对应的装配工艺流程图。装配工艺流程图反映了装配单元的划分和隶属关系、零部件的装配顺序、平行工作内容及检验项目等。装配流程图由主标题栏、装配节点、汇合节点、开始节点、结束节点和节点连线组成,其中装配节点包括关键工序节点和普通工序节点。每个装配节点都具有额定工时,装配节点表示了装配工作的具体操作和检验内容,节点连线表示装配工作流向,开始节点表示了装配流程图的开始标志,结束节点表示了装配流程图的结束标志。每个装配流程图包括唯一的一个主流程和若干辅流程,如图2所示。汇合节点表示了主流程和辅流程的交点标志。图2 某部件的装配工艺流程图的组成示意图 装配节点的信息加载,是指针对每个装配节点(例如图2中的每个工序节点),将完成该装配节点所需要的工艺文件、模型文件、多媒体文件、物料齐套、检验控制卡等信息加载到该装配节点。每个具体的装配节点需要加载的信息主要包括:该工序的基本信息,包括该工序的执行车间、所属型号等;工序内容,包括详细的工序内容描述;工位信息,主要包括该工序所涉及的装配小组人员名单及各类人员的责任;检验要求信息,包括装配过程中的检验要求和规则;其它齐套信息,包括完成该装配节点所需要的零部件配套清单、标准件配套清单、工装与工具清单、设计图纸文件清单、各种附件和标准规范等。 装配工艺报表输出,是指从生成的装配工艺流程图中提取相关信息,并自动输出企业要求的装配工艺卡片和各种工艺报表。 1.2 车间作业计划制定层 车间调度员接收到厂级调度下发的装配计划(即型号任务和临时任务)后,依据装配工艺流程图进行车间作业计划制定。主要包括装配计划拆分、装配任务与装配工艺流程图绑定、基于装配工艺流程图的作业计划制定三部分。 1)装配计划拆分:车间调度员对接收到的装配计划进行拆分(将一个装配计划细分为1个或多个装配任务)。例如,假设接收到的装配计划为装配A型号10个,装配B型号5个;则车间调度员可将装配计划分解为3个子装配任务,即装配任务1:装配A型号5个;装配任务2:装配A型号5个;装配任务3:装配B型号5个。拆分后的三个装配任务可能分别下发给车间装配小组1、小组2和小组3。装配计划的拆分过程中必须遵守的规则是:拆分后的每个装配任务只能与唯一的具体产品对应,也即一个装配任务中不能涉及两个或两个以上的具体产品的装配工作。 2)装配任务与装配工艺流程图绑定:车间调度员将每个装配任务与产品装配工艺流程图绑定。通过绑定后,可将对复杂产品的装配过程控制转换为对装配工艺流程图中的一系列装配节点的控制。 3)基于装配工艺流程图的作业计划制定:通过装配任务与装配工艺流程图的绑定,车间调度员将对每个装配任务的控制转换为对实际装配工艺流程图的控制,并基于装配工艺流程图进行每个装配节点的作业计划制定。例如针对图2所示部件的装配工艺流程,可根据装配工艺流程图中每个装配节点的额定工时和所下发的装配任务的要求完成时间进行倒序计算,自动获得每个装配节点的要求完成日期,如图3所示。同时,车间调度员还可在自动调度的基础上,对关键工序节点的要求完成日期进行人工调度。 图3 某部件的生产作业计划1.3 车间作业计划执行层 车间装配工人依据流程化的装配工艺流程图进行装配作业,在装配实施过程中,通过对装配节点的颜色标识,来实现对装配进度的实时可视化展示和监控。 装配小组依据装配工艺流程图进行产品装配的过程中,需要对每个装配节点进行检验,并实时采集相关装配数据,检验员需将采集到的实时检验数据填入,并电子签字确认后,才能开展后续装配操作。 系统将自动记录每一个装配节点的实际完成时间,并自动对后续普通装配节点的要求完成时间进行实时更新,对于关键装配节点的要求完成时间的修改,则需要车间调度人员人工确认。 装配过程中,各级管理人员(包括车间主任、厂级调度人员、车间调度人员)能够实时获得整个装配车间的装配进度,并实时获得各种装配数据报表(包括关键检验点检测结果汇总表、产品装配进展日报表、装配车间总装测试进展一览表等)。2 系统体系结构和功能结构2.1 VPPC系统的功能结构 VPPC系统的功能结构如图4所示,主要功能模块包括: 1)装配资源统一管理:为VPPC系统提供统一的数据源,并实现与PDM系统的信息集成。具体包括统一的产品装配BOM生成和维护、装配生产数据管理、基于装配BOM的装配工艺数据管理、基于装配BOM的装配工艺流程管理、装配工艺数据的版本管理等。 2)装配工艺流程生成与管理:接收工艺准备计划,完成装配工艺流程图的制作和工艺报表的输出。具体包括工艺准备计划管理(工艺流程图制作任务的接收、下发、认领及审签)、装配工艺流程图生成、装配节点的信息加载和装配工艺报表输出等。 3)车间装配作业计划调度:接收装配计划,完成车间装配作业计划调度。具体包括装配计划管理(厂级装配计划的接收、下发、认领及反馈)、装配计划拆分、装配任务与装配工艺流程图绑定、基于装配工艺流程图的作业计划制定等。 4)可视化装配综合看板和数据统计:完成车间作业执行和数据统计分析。具体包括装配工艺集成展示、装配工位数据采集、装配进度监控和装配数据统计分析等。图4VPPC系统的功能结构图2.2 VPPC系统的总体结构 VPPC系统的总体结构如图5所示。VPPC系统使用了Microsoft基于.NET Framework 3.5的WCSF框架结构。其中WCSF框架实现了系统的Web应用,主要包括系统中与用户交互的表现层页面:如用户管理、组织机构管理、装配资源管理、装配流程管理、工艺准备计划管理、装配流程工艺生成、装配计划管理、装配任务管理、装配工艺展示、装配数据采集、统计分析等以及系统使用的公用模块:导入导出模块(实现用户数据、BOM数据的导入导出)。在数据访问模块中,根据系统的需要,在业务逻辑层中封装对数据库各表的操作:如添加用户,修改用户等。WCSF框架可调用数据访问模块发布的接口函数来获得系统数据库的数据以及操作信息等。流程定制器是一个.Net WinForm控件,嵌入到网页中,它通过调用Web服务实现数据库的操作。使用WCSF框架使VPPC系统层次更清晰,开发效率更高,维护也更方便。图5VPPC系统的总体结构 3 系统实现的关键技术3.1 基于装配BOM的静态装配数据管理 产品静态装配数据主要包括产品设计BOM、装配工艺文件信息和装配生产信息。其中装配工艺文件信息包括管理性装配工艺文件、专用工艺装备明细表、专用工具和量具明细表、主要材料消耗明细表、辅助材料消耗明细表、配套明细表、装配工艺卡片等;装配生产信息主要包括完成产品装配工作所需要的装配保障条件,如装配测量器具检查记录表、装配测试设备记录表、非金属材料有效期检查记录、工艺装备检查记录表、装配技术文件检查记录表、零部件检查记录表等。产品静态装配数据管理是实现全面装配数据管理的基础。 针对复杂产品现场装配特点,提出了一种基于装配BOM的装配资源信息统一管理方法。即针对每个批次的复杂产品,都形成一个统一的装配BOM。该装配BOM全面列出了完成该批次产品装配所需要的装配保障条件信息和装配工艺信息,具体包括产品零部件之间的组合和装配关系、装
网站客服QQ:2055934822
金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号